<blockquote data-quote="azsugarbear" data-source="post: 2352074" data-attributes="member: 4809"><p>1) I believe an absolute must for anyone from out-of-state that plans hunting in WY should have OnX Maps (or equivalent) on their phone. Some areas looks like a chessboard of private/public land. The app will show you what is public vs private and often give you contact info for private holdings.</p><p></p><p>2) Finding bucks will not be a problem. Judging them is a different story. Watch some videos and learn how to field judge an antelope. If shooting a trophy is not important to you - then just enjoy the experience.</p></blockquote><p></p>
